26 storm victims in Sekinchan receive RM300

SHAH ALAM, 25 May: A total of 26 storm victim recipients in Sekinchan received an assistance of RM300 which was presented by its Assemblyman, Ng Suee Lim, at a ceremony at the Nurul Falah Hall recently.

Suee Lim said that the contribution is to alleviate the catastrophe of disaster that hit the victims.

“We hope that it would help the victims a little in repairing the damages to their homes,” he said.

Selangor Kini understands that the recipients’ homes were damaged by a storm that hit in April.

At the same time, Suee Lim wants the people of Sekinchan to take the opportunity to apply for the Hijrah Scheme introduced by the state government to those interested in business.

“No interest is charged. It is the proper channel for borrowers and to avoid the people from borrowing from loan sharks.

“The state government also wants to help the people increase their income and facilitate taking out loans because of the relaxation of conditions compared to bank loans,” he said.
